Ok....this might be a stupid question but....is it remotely possible to swap a GEM out of a '97 XL into a '98 XLT that has stuff the '97 doesn't have re: power windows, Power locks etc.? I know the GEM in the '98 is acting weird and the one in the '97 is perfectly fine. If anyone has insight, please share ! Thanks in advance.

I have replaced my GEM 3 times now. The first time I replaced I found one with the same exact programming number and it still had to be programmed to get certain things to function correctly. You will need to take out the one in you truck and find one with match numbers then have to have it programmed by the dealer. Also the truck it self will run but will not shift right and certain interior items will not function correctly till it has been programmed.
